Sink into a soothing symphony and allow the healing vibrations to restore balance to your mind, body and spirit. An immersive soundscape composed of therapeutic and sensory instruments, including gongs, tuning forks, alchemy singing bowls, chimes and nature sounds, alongside various sensory cues and scents takes listeners on a journey deep into the inner-landscape to foster states of clarity, restoration and deep-healing.

The Sensory Sound Journey is a process of reconnection - harmonizing the listener with self and to the world around them. We mark the opening of the space with an energetic cleansing and a short breath meditation to regulate the nervous system before seamlessly blending into a relaxing multisensory sound bath to enable the listener’s unique healing process to unfold.

Often described as "powerful", "unforgettable" and "inspiring", participants lie down and close their eyes to experience a rich spectrum of immersive sound in this easeful and blissful restorative practice from the comfort of their mat.
